In government and politics, Shapiro's proposed $53.3 billion budget highlights economic growth with over 21,500 new jobs and $39 billion in private investment, but the Independent Fiscal Office warns of billions in deficits by 2027-28 without cuts or new revenue. Recent laws include mandating cursive handwriting in schools, championed by Sen. Wayne Langerholc, joining 18 other states. Business thrives with a $3 million grant to expand Steamfitters Local 420's training center for apprentices in high-demand fields like Amazon's $20 billion AI campuses and Eli Lilly's $3.5 billion drug facility, per the Department of Community and Economic Development. The Shapiro administration also allocated over $56 million to 13 community colleges for renovations, boosting workforce readiness, says the Department of Education. Poultry investments support the $7.1 billion industry, per PennLive.
Public safety officials warn against icy rivers due to unstable conditions, and a new state report on AI addresses data center growth, privacy, and workforce impacts amid community concerns. Pennsylvania ranks top for business survival under Shapiro, MyChesCo notes.
Looking Ahead, watch budget negotiations amid deficit projections, 2026 elections that could flip legislative control, and cannabis talks during election-year pressure.
